An exceptional answer
When implementing blockchain technology, it is vital to carefully consider and address the ethical considerations and challenges that may arise. One of the key considerations is the privacy and protection of sensitive data. Blockchain's inherent transparency can be problematic when dealing with personal or confidential information. To mitigate this, I would employ encryption techniques such as homomorphic encryption or secure multi-party computation to ensure the confidentiality of sensitive data. Additionally, implementing strong access controls and user permissions can regulate data access and prevent unauthorized disclosure. Another challenge is the potential for fraudulent or illegal activities on the blockchain. To combat this, I would integrate digital identity solutions to verify the identity of participants and discourage illicit behavior. This could involve leveraging self-sovereign identity frameworks and decentralized identity systems. Regular audits and consensus-based decision-making processes can further enhance the integrity and trustworthiness of the blockchain network. Lastly, the environmental impact of blockchain mining is a concern. To address this, I would explore renewable energy sources for mining operations and advocate for the adoption of energy-efficient consensus mechanisms like proof-of-stake or proof-of-authority. By carefully considering and addressing these ethical considerations, we can ensure the responsible and sustainable implementation of blockchain technology.
